PYA is seeking a Business Development Manager to join its high-performing accounting and advisory services firm with a dynamic culture and strong national reputation.
The Business Development Manager will contribute to the growth and development of PYA’s professional services including audit and assurance, tax, accounting, and management consulting, including litigation support.
These services are routinely provided to clients operating in a variety of industries including healthcare, banking, real estate, and other for-profit and non-profit organizations.
The ideal candidate will initially focus on business development efforts in the PYA office location in which the candidate resides;
however, this professional will also have the opportunity to become a key contributor to growing relationships with prospective and current clients throughout the nation.
Responsibilities
- Reporting to the Chief Development Officer, the ideal candidate will work with PYA executives and the Business Development team to drive awareness and build relationships in designated markets and pursue potential business leads
- Collaborating with PYA professionals and practice groups to develop a customized and measurable approach to growing and retaining clients
- Assisting PYA service line leaders with the execution of their business development plans
- Connecting firm prospects / clients with PYA professionals to enhance total organizational value
- Identifying and researching prospective clients and new business opportunities from existing clients or new contacts
- Seeking and establishing partnerships with other professionals such as attorneys, commercial bankers, investment bankers, and various investor groups
- Consistently seeking new knowledge about the firm and effectively implementing such knowledge in one’s daily function
- Partnering with PYA management / staff in proposal development and guiding the sales process to enhance the success ratio for each identified opportunity
- Evaluating cross-marketing opportunities of existing PYA (+ Affiliates’) clients
Qualifications
- 3 years of business and / or relationship development experience required
- Experience working for a professional services firm is preferred
- Healthcare, banking, or real estate industries experience is a plus, including payroll services
- Proficiency in lead generation via social media, referrals and networking, proposal development, and other proven lead generation methods
- Personal network across the Tampa, Charlotte or Atlanta community is preferred
- Executive presence with an ability to interact with senior leadership
- Outstanding written and oral communication skills
- Exceptional client service attitude and demeanor
- Creative problem-solving abilities and a results-oriented mindset
- Some travel is required, including event attendance and active participation in industry associations or other organizations relevant to PYA’s target audience
About PYA
Ranked among the top CPA firms in the nation by USA Today, Forbes, and INSIDE Public Accounting, PYA is also a leader in the percentage of female ownership.
We are a Top 15 auditor of the nation’s largest health systems and are consistently ranked as one of the country’s Top 20 healthcare consulting firms by Modern Healthcare.
Serving clients in all 50 states from our headquarters in Knoxville, as well as offices in Atlanta, Charlotte, Kansas City, Nashville, and Tampa, PYA provides expertise in tax, audit and assurance, IT, and management consulting.
PYA’s success results from four decades of steadfast adherence to a culture of responsiveness, integrity, and relationships both with clients and colleagues "The PYA Way.
